The 2001 Volkswagen Sharan is noticeably less reliable than the UK average, with a first-time pass rate of just 68.3% against the national baseline of 80%; more concerning, 32% of these vehicles have recorded a dangerous defect at some point, making safety a genuine buyer consideration. Petrol and diesel variants perform almost identically (68.7% and 68.1% respectively), so fuel type won't help you pick a better example.

At 114,620 miles median, these Sharans show typical wear for their age, yet they're generating serious maintenance needs with an average of 4.86 failures per test and 23.5 advisories—suggesting mechanical fragility rather than age-related decline. If you're considering one, budget for substantial repairs and get a thorough pre-purchase inspection focusing on suspension, brakes, and cooling systems, since the high failure and dangerous defect rates point to systemic weak spots across the model.

What tends to go wrong

Across 3,798 vehicles — figures show how many had each issue flagged at least once in their MOT history.

Tyre wear 89.1%
Nearside Front Tyre worn close to the legal limit · Offside Front Tyre worn close to the legal limit · Offside Rear Tyre worn close to the legal limit · …
Budget for a full set — on a vehicle this age, tyres are expected consumables. An inspection will confirm how much is left.
Lighting 72%
Nearside Front Macpherson strut has slight movement at the upper attachment · Offside Front Macpherson strut has slight movement at the upper attachment · Nearside Front position lamp(s) not working · …
Usually cheap to fix. Worth confirming all lights work before collecting.
Brake wear 60.8%
Offside Rear Brake pipe slightly corroded · Nearside Rear Brake pipe slightly corroded · Offside Front Brake pipe slightly corroded · …
Ask the seller when brakes were last serviced. If they don't know, factor in the cost.

Pass Rate by Fuel Type

Fuel type Vehicles Pass rate Avg failures
Diesel (67%) 2,545 68.1% 4.92
Petrol (33%) 1,244 68.7% 4.73
